The UK tipping convention: 10% standard, 12.5% common as optional service charge. Tipping above this is appreciated but not expected.

Many UK restaurants add an optional service charge (typically 12.5%) to the bill automatically. Check before tipping again.

Worked examples
£100 bill, 10% tip = £10 (£110 total).
£100 bill, 12.5% service charge already added = no additional tip needed.

Should I tip on top of service charge?
Usually no — service charge already covers the tip. Only tip extra if service was exceptional.
Are tips taxed?
From 2024, the Employment (Allocation of Tips) Act requires tips to be passed to staff fully and fairly. They're taxable as earnings.
